.NET is a managed-software framework. It implements a subset of the .NET framework APIs and several new APIs, and it includes a CLR implementation. New versions of .NET that address a security vulnerability are now available. The updated versions are .NET SDK 5.0.208 and .NET Runtime 5.0.11. Security Fix(es): dotnet: System.DirectoryServices.Protocols.LdapConnection sends credentials in plaintext if TLS handshake fails (CVE-2021-41355) For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, acknowledgments,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.
